What is Dabigatran Etexilate?
Dabigatran Etexilate Eg Labo is an oral medication used to prevent blood clots. It is commonly prescribed for conditions like atrial fibrillation and deep vein thrombosis. This anticoagulant helps reduce the risk of stroke and other clot-related issues.

What are the side effects of Dabigatran Etexilate?
Common effects of Dabigatran Etexilate Eg Labo may include bleeding more easily than usual. This can manifest as nosebleeds, bleeding gums, or longer-than-normal bleeding from cuts. Some users may also experience stomach pain, heartburn, or indigestion. It is important to monitor for any signs of unusual bleeding, as this could indicate a serious side effect.

What does Dabigatran Etexilate interact with?
Dabigatran Etexilate Eg Labo can interact with a variety of medications, including other blood thinners, n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), and certain antibiotics. Alcohol consumption should be limited, as it can increase the risk of bleeding. Always consult your healthcare provider before starting or stopping any medication while taking Dabigatran Etexilate.
